We're back for our fifth season of The Koren Podcast asking our guests to teach us their Torah al regel ahat - standing on one leg.
We were joined this week by Rachel Goldberg and Jon Polin, the parents of Hersh Goldberg-Polin who, at the time of recording, has been held hostage by Hamas terrorists for 136 days.

Hersh is one of 134 people who have been held in captivity since October 7th and, as Rachel and Jon say, they have been living every parent's worst nightmare. Rachel and Jon have been working, and worrying, around the clock for nearly 5 months to get any information they can about their son and secure his release.
Despite the unfathomable situation in which they find themselves, Rachel and Jon have displayed unbelievable poise and courage while meeting with presidents, celebrities, and even the pope to ensure that the world does not forget about this humanitarian crisis.
One thing that Jon and Rachel have been vocal about is how their faith has been a source of inspiration and guidance during such a difficult time and allowed them to continue the fight to bring their son home.
Listen now as they share their Torah al regel ahat.
